3.4.2 Important Notice of Servicing
This camera unit has the personal information of wireless LAN connection the customer has registered.
For the protection of private information, please erase the personal information after the completion of repair by "Initial Settings".
In addition, please print out the following documents, and pass to the customer with the camera unit.

3.5 General Description About Lead Free Solder (PbF)

The lead free solder has been used in the mounting process of all electrical components on the printed circuit boards used for this equipment in
considering the globally environmental conservation.
The normal solder is the alloy of tin (Sn) and lead (Pb). On the other hand, the lead free solder is the alloy mainly consists of tin (Sn), silver (Ag)
and copper (Cu), and the melting point of the lead free solder is higher approx.30°C (86°F) more than that of the normal solder.
Distinction of P.C.B. Lead Free Solder being used
Service caution for repair work using Lead Free Solder (PbF)
The lead free solder has to be used when repairing the equipment for which the lead free solder is used.
(Defnition: The letter of "PbF" is printed on the P.C.B. using the lead free solder.)
To put lead free solder, it should be well molten and mixed with the original lead free solder.
Remove the remaining lead free solder on the P.C.B. cleanly for soldering of the new IC.
Since the melting point of the lead free solder is higher than that of the normal lead solder, it takes the longer time to melt the lead free
solder.
Use the soldering iron (more than 70W) equipped with the temperature control after setting the temperature at 350±30°C (662±86°F).
